
在进行SPSS生存分析时,处理截尾数据是一个关键步骤。截尾数据代表了在研究期间未发生事件的个体,这些数据需要特别标记和处理。我们需要在数据集里对这些个体进行标记,以便在分析中正确区分。具体来说,可以使用一个事件变量来指示是否发生了感兴趣的事件,例如死亡或故障。如果事件发生,则赋值为1;如果未发生(即截尾),则赋值为0。这种标记方式确保了SPSS在分析生存时间时能够正确处理这些截尾数据。在SPSS中,可以使用“生存分析”功能模块,通过“时间”和“状态”变量来进行分析。接下来,我们将详细介绍如何在SPSS中录入和处理截尾数据。
一、收集和准备数据
在进行任何分析之前,数据的收集和准备是至关重要的。首先,需要确保数据的完整性和准确性。收集数据时要确保每个个体的生存时间和事件状态都被准确记录。生存时间可以是从研究开始到事件发生的时间长度,或者到研究结束时未发生事件的时间长度。事件状态变量用于指示事件是否发生,通常用0表示截尾数据,用1表示事件发生。
二、在SPSS中录入数据
启动SPSS软件,打开一个新的数据集。在数据视图中,创建两列:一列用于生存时间,另一列用于事件状态。确保每一行代表一个个体的记录。例如,生存时间列可以命名为“Survival_Time”,事件状态列可以命名为“Event_Status”。对于每个个体,输入其生存时间和事件状态,例如,如果某个个体在研究期间未发生事件,则其事件状态应为0,生存时间为其研究时间长度。
三、定义变量属性
在变量视图中,定义每个变量的属性。生存时间变量应定义为数值型数据,事件状态变量也应定义为数值型数据,但要设置为离散值。对于事件状态变量,可以为0和1设置标签,0代表截尾,1代表事件发生。这有助于在分析结果中更好地理解数据。
四、选择生存分析方法
在SPSS中,有多种生存分析方法可供选择,如Kaplan-Meier法、Cox回归模型等。选择适合研究目的和数据特性的分析方法。例如,如果希望估计生存函数,可以选择Kaplan-Meier法;如果希望探索多个变量对生存时间的影响,可以选择Cox回归模型。
五、进行生存分析
选择“分析”菜单下的“生存分析”选项,根据选择的分析方法,输入所需的变量。以Kaplan-Meier法为例,选择“Kaplan-Meier”选项,将生存时间变量拖入“时间”框,将事件状态变量拖入“状态”框。点击“确定”后,SPSS将生成生存曲线和相关统计结果。
六、解释和报告结果
分析结果的解释是研究的关键部分。生存曲线可以直观展示不同组别的生存概率变化,事件状态的显著性检验结果可以帮助判断组间差异是否显著。在报告中,应详细描述分析方法、数据处理方式和结果解释,确保读者能够理解研究的意义和结论。
七、处理数据缺失与异常值
在实际研究中,可能会遇到数据缺失或异常值问题。数据缺失可以通过多种方法处理,如删除缺失值、插补缺失值等。异常值的识别和处理也很重要,可以通过统计图表或统计检验方法识别异常值,并根据实际情况决定是保留、删除还是调整异常值。
八、验证模型假设
生存分析中,模型假设的验证是确保分析结果可靠性的关键。例如,Cox回归模型假设比例风险,验证这一假设可以使用Schoenfeld残差检验。如果假设不满足,需要考虑其他分析方法或对数据进行变换处理。
九、结合其他分析方法
生存分析结果可以与其他统计分析方法结合使用,以获得更全面的研究结论。例如,可以结合回归分析、方差分析等方法,探讨影响生存时间的因素及其交互作用,增加研究的深度和广度。
十、利用数据可视化工具
数据可视化工具可以帮助更直观地展示生存分析结果。SPSS自带的图表功能可以生成生存曲线、风险函数等图表,此外还可以使用其他数据可视化工具,如FineBI,来创建更丰富的可视化报表,提升数据展示效果。FineBI是帆软旗下的一款产品,适用于多种数据分析和可视化需求。
十一、应用生存分析结果
生存分析结果的应用可以帮助在实际场景中做出更科学的决策。例如,在医疗领域,可以根据生存分析结果优化治疗方案,提高患者的生存率;在工程领域,可以根据设备的生存分析结果改进维护策略,延长设备的使用寿命。
十二、持续更新数据和分析方法
生存分析是一个动态过程,随着研究的进行和新数据的收集,分析方法和结果也需要不断更新。定期回顾和更新数据,采用最新的分析方法,可以确保研究结果的准确性和可靠性。
在SPSS中处理截尾数据是生存分析的重要步骤,通过科学的方法和合理的工具,可以获得可靠的研究结论,助力科学决策和应用。了解更多FineBI的相关信息,可以访问FineBI官网: https://s.fanruan.com/f459r;。
相关问答FAQs:
1. 什么是截尾数据,在SPSS生存分析中如何定义截尾数据?
截尾数据是指在生存分析中,某些观测值在特定时间点之前并没有经历事件(如故障、死亡等),或某些观测值在研究期间内被观察到,但在研究结束时未经历事件。截尾数据在生存分析中是非常重要的,因为它们提供了有关生存时间的额外信息,而不只是事件发生的个体。因此,在SPSS中进行生存分析时,正确地录入和定义截尾数据是至关重要的。
在SPSS中,截尾数据的录入通常涉及到两个变量:生存时间和状态变量。生存时间是指个体从开始观察到事件发生或数据截尾的时间长度,而状态变量则用来指示个体是否经历了事件。一般来说,可以使用0和1来表示状态变量,0表示个体在观察结束时未经历事件(即截尾),而1则表示个体经历了事件。
2. 如何在SPSS中录入截尾数据以进行生存分析?
在SPSS中录入截尾数据的步骤相对简单。首先,你需要建立一个数据集,其中包括每个个体的生存时间和状态变量。以下是具体的步骤:
-
创建数据集:打开SPSS,选择“文件”>“新建”>“数据集”,然后开始输入数据。每一行代表一个个体,列包括生存时间(如“生存时间”)和状态(如“状态”)。
-
输入生存时间:在生存时间列中输入每个个体从起始观察到事件发生或数据截尾的时间长度。例如,如果一个个体观察了5年但在此期间没有经历事件,则生存时间为5。
-
输入状态变量:在状态列中输入对应的状态。对于经历事件的个体,输入1;对于在观察结束时未经历事件的个体,输入0。
-
检查数据完整性:确保没有缺失值,并且生存时间和状态变量的输入符合逻辑。
-
保存数据集:选择“文件”>“保存”,将数据保存为SPSS格式文件,以便后续分析。
通过这样的方式,你可以在SPSS中准确录入截尾数据,为后续的生存分析打下坚实的基础。
3. 在SPSS中使用生存分析时,如何选择合适的分析方法?
在SPSS中进行生存分析时,选择合适的分析方法取决于研究的目的和数据的特性。以下是几种常见的生存分析方法及其适用情况:
-
Kaplan-Meier方法:这种方法适用于描述生存函数,尤其是在处理截尾数据时。通过Kaplan-Meier曲线,可以直观地展示不同时间点的生存概率。它非常适合于比较不同组别(如治疗组和对照组)之间的生存情况。
-
Cox比例风险模型:如果研究者希望分析多个因素对生存时间的影响,Cox模型是一种非常有效的选择。此模型允许研究者同时考虑多个协变量,并评估它们对生存风险的影响。使用Cox模型时,确保数据满足比例风险假设是非常重要的。
-
Log-rank检验:当需要比较两个或多个组的生存曲线时,Log-rank检验是一个常用的方法。它可以检验不同组之间生存曲线的差异是否显著。
在选择合适的分析方法时,研究者应考虑数据的特性、研究目标以及假设检验的要求。确保在数据分析之前,清楚了解不同方法的适用条件和假设,以便做出最佳选择。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



